Principal Katerina Palomares Link to this section

Principal Katerina Palomares joined Junipero Serra Elementary School in 2021, adding to her decades of dedicated service and leadership within the San Francisco Unified School District. She began her career in 1998 as a Spanish bilingual elementary educator, cultivating a passion for culturally responsive teaching and strong family partnerships. Her experiences in the classroom led her into school leadership, where she has served as both Assistant Principal and Principal across a range of SFUSD school communities.

Principal Palomares has brought her expertise to school sites throughout San Francisco, including those in Chinatown, Lake Merced, and the Excelsior/Portola District. Her leadership is grounded in equity, inclusion, and a deep commitment to supporting every student’s academic and social-emotional growth. As the leader of a community school, she champions a whole-child approach that integrates academics, wellness, family partnership, and community resources. Known for her strong, steady leadership, she proudly shares this vision and experience to the vibrant, diverse community of Junipero Serra Elementary in Bernal Heights, where she continues to foster a collaborative, student-centered school culture.
